In an interview given to Movistar+, Joao Felix, currently on loan from Atletico Madrid to FC Barcelona, ​​has (finally) spoken about his future. If the Seleção international Das Quinas (35 caps, 7 goals) took the opportunity to send a message to Antoine Griezmann, he actually also said more about his future while… Mundo Deportivo He claims the Blaugrana have made a move to keep the Portuguese striker.

“I’m happy here. If I stay, I’m fine, my family is fine and we’ll see what happens in the future.”Thus, the player scored 4 goals and provided 3 assists in 16 matches in all competitions since the beginning of the season. An unambiguously auspicious exit for Barcelona, ​​intent on keeping the No. 14 after his loan spell. It now remains to find common ground with the Colchoneros. To try to facilitate the pursuit of an agreement, the Portuguese has another idea in mind, as the rest of his interview with Iberian TV suggests.

In fact, while he has already been this summer, the former Benfica player appears to want to make himself completely unpopular at Madrid when he returns from loan next summer. In any case, this is what its exit from the moon on Friday suggests. Ironically, the versatile striker highlighted the attacking shyness of his former club: “Of course I prefer this style at Barcelona, ​​myself and all the players. If you ask every player, and if you also ask Atletico players, they prefer to play longer in attack, that’s for sure. If they don’t answer this question, they are lying. Of course, every player wants to attack, possess the ball, and score goals.»

As he made his speech that would cause a sensation in the capital, the 23-year-old striker, who has scored four goals this season for Barcelona, ​​calmed things down, saying that playing again against his former teammates on Sunday (9pm) will be difficult. Be a special moment:It’s a special match for me. Atletico has been my home for the last four years, so of course I left there and had a good time. It’s always special to play against my former teammates. It will be good to see them again and see how we play against them.“One thing is certain, the meeting might be taken seriously by the Matelassier family who must not have been very thrilled to hear the words of their former comrade…
